MA Online: The 12 Questions
Ask
yourself these twelve questions to determine whether marijuana is
a problem in your life
- Has smoking pot stopped being fun?
- Do you ever get high alone?
- Is it hard for you to imagine a life without marijuana?
- Do you find that your friends are determined by your marijuana
use?
- Do you smoke marijuana to avoid dealing with your problems?
- Do you smoke pot to cope with your feelings?
- Does your marijuana use let you live in a privately defined world?
- Have you ever failed to keep promises you made about cutting down
or controlling your dope smoking?
- Has your use of marijuana caused problems with memory, concentration,
or motivation?
- When your stash is nearly empty, do you feel anxious or worried
about how to get more?
- Do you plan your life around your marijuana use?
- Have friends or relatives ever complained that your pot smoking
is damaging your relationship with them?
If you answered yes to one or more of these questions,
you may have a problem with pot.
